ICOC 2027 to take place in Brescia

The International Conference on Oriental Carpets (ICOC) will return to Italy next year. From 27 to 30 May 2027, the historic northern Italian city of Brescia will host the XVI ICOC. Dr Peter Bichler, Chairman of the ICOC International Committee, and organiser Alberto Boralevi selected the new location after initial plans for Milan were set aside due to high costs. The Centro Paolo VI conference centre, situated in the heart of the old town, will serve as the main venue. The ICOC is co-operating closely with the Tassara Foundation and the MITA Museum (Museum of Antique Carpets in Brescia), which houses one of the most significant rug collections in Europe. In addition to lectures, the programme is set to include a Dealer’s Fair for up to 70 exhibitors and exhibitions of notable private collections. Milan may still feature in the programme through post-conference excursions.
